Original Description
Bathed in the golden glow of the Mediterranean sun, Sidi-bou-Said by Paul-Émile Dubois (1885-1949) transports viewers to the iconic Tunisian hillside village with its rhythmic whitewashed houses and azure-blue doors. Painted in the early 20th century, Dubois’ work exemplifies Orientalist influences blended with Post-Impressionist vitality—thick, expressive brushstrokes capture the play of light on cubic architecture, while vibrant local details (flowering bougainvillea, ceramic tiles) celebrate North African culture. Though less famous than works by Matisse who also painted Sidi-bou-Said, Dubois’ piece holds historical significance as part of the colonial-era artistic dialogue between Europe and North Africa, offering both romanticized charm and authentic topographical precision. The painting’s balanced composition—where geometric structures harmonize with organic foliage—reflects Dubois’ academic training and his fascination with "picturesque" exoticism, making it a subtle yet valuable piece in Orientalist art history.
